What is 4G Mobile Technology?

4G mobile technology is how people refer to the next generation of mobile services like the cell phones. It was just made available by at least one provider in a number of places in the US in 2009. Because it is still fresh, there is no established industry standard yet as to what constitutes 4G mobile. Thus, it is simply a marketing term in the mean time.
The letter G, used to shorten the word generation, in the mobile technology world covers the noticeable advances of the past 20-20 years. 1 G technology covered the first widely available mobile phones. Its successor, the 2G technology, began in the early 1990s - switching to a digital format and introduced the concept of text messaging. 3G technology made its mark by improving the way how data is carried, making it possible to have enhanced information services like websites in their original format. The famous iPhone is the best known example of this technology.
4G mobile technology is not yet established to have an agreed set of standards and protocols. This implies that its current features are simply goals and are not yet the full requirements. 4G mobile technology is still in the phase of developing enhanced security measures, since data transfer schemes are drastically increasing. Another 4G mobile technology goal is to overcome and minimize the blips in transmission when one device moves from one area to another covered by different networks. Another thing that 4G mobile technology is still working on is to figure out a way to use a network based on the IP address system used for the internet.
In the United States alone, there are two major systems using the 4G mobile technology. The first one is known as WiMax and is backed by Clearwire - a firm whose primary owner is Sprint Nextel. It began its testing phase of the system in Baltimore in 2008 and was set to expand overwhelmingly into major markets in 2009. The rival system is Long Term Evolution or LTE, which is backed by Verizon. It is expected to be ready for testing in 2010 but will not be available for use until 2012. LTE is hoping to overcome this disadvantage by providing faster speeds and producing cheaper equipment.
Unlike the previous generations of mobile technology, 4G mobile will be mainly used for internet access on computers and carrying cell phone communications. Customers in areas which have a strong 4G coverage can use it for a home broadband connection without needing any cables to be mounted in their household. It can also be used for accessing the internet outside the home without having to be stuck in a wireless hotspot like those that are offered by some coffee shops, airports and libraries.
